When's the best time to book a family-friendly holiday in Bergerac?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 21°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 7°C. Average annual precipitation for Bergerac is 829 mm.
What's there to see and do with your family in Bergerac?
While you are visiting Bergerac, you and the family may want to explore some interesting spots such as Musée du Tabac, Port Miniature and Labyrinthe Vegetal Les Fees Meres. Make sure that you have lots of time for activities such as Moulin de la Rouzique and Zoo de Mescoules.
What's the best way for us to get around Bergerac?
If you want to venture outside the area, hop aboard a train at Bergerac Station. Bergerac might not have very many public transport options, so consider renting a car to explore more.
